Its a well known fact of life that Lara Bars are delicious. These homemade Lara Bars, courtesy of the above referenced website, were really good too! The recipe yields two bars.

Here's the recipe:

Very Cherry Bars

1/4 cup chopped dates (roughly chopped whole dates, not pre-chopped)
1/4 cup dried cherries or dried cranberries [I used Craisins]
1/3 cup whole pecans, almonds or walnuts [I used cashews]
1/8 teaspoon cinnamon
1/2 TBSP peanut butter [I used crunchy Skippy]*

____________________________________________________
1)Pulse dates and cherries in a food processor (This is where my Magic Bullet came into handy) until processed to a paste; transfer to medium bowl.

2) Add the nuts and cinnamon to the Magic Bullet and pulse until finely chopped. Add the nut mixture to the fruit paste.

3) Use your fingers to knead the nuts into the fruit paste.

4) Divide mixture in half. Place each half on a sheet of plastic wrap, and use hands to form the bars.

Notes: * While the peanut butter was not included in the original recipe, I added it to the mixture since it was so dry and did not hold its form well. It was a tasty addition. It would be fun to roll out the dough and use cookie cutters!

As far as the mixture being a little on the arid side, it may be attributable to the dates I used. The ones I used were purchased in a plastic container.
